titleOfInvention PROCESS FOR PREPARING 3'-FLUOR-2 ', 3'-DIDESOXYGUANOSINE
abstract The invention relates to a process for the preparation of 3'-fluoro-2 ', 3'-dideoxyguanosine. The method is applicable in the pharmaceutical industry and the product produced can be used as an antiviral and cancerostatic agent. According to the invention, in a transglycosidation reaction, the sugar residue of 5'-O-acetyl-3'-fluoro-3'-deoxythymidine is transferred to the tristrimethylsilyl derivative of N-high 2-palmitoylguanine under the catalytic action of trimethylsilyl triflate in acetonitrile.
